Transaction 3148c2866fb3e496b4b794e28b75d4cd0346472178ea703bb51529d414148e8f

4 Input
2 Outputs
  • 3148c2866fb3e496b4b794e28b75d4cd0346472178ea703bb51529d414148e8f:0
  • value  99960000
    address  3PEo6aia8AbibuN5xCX9k5GwZvR5wLNZjv
  • 3148c2866fb3e496b4b794e28b75d4cd0346472178ea703bb51529d414148e8f:1
  • value  50982327436
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g